Output db3bee523d21f628ff9af710dd27bcd236649973bc4640f096b26975dff6e55f:0

value
50603048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e1ddae83a6fa6942801ab6f4bb0bf12acfe8184 OP_EQUAL
address
3EeTe9pHw17AaV9XmSWXHAtxmDuT6magEK
transaction
db3bee523d21f628ff9af710dd27bcd236649973bc4640f096b26975dff6e55f
confirmations
270500
spent
true